The Alto Saxophone's Role
The alto saxophone, with its warm and lyrical sound, carries the melody of "Amazing Grace." The player's breath control and phrasing are crucial in conveying the song's emotional depth. The alto saxophone's flexibility allows for subtle variations in articulation, creating a nuanced and expressive performance.
The Tenor Saxophone's Support
The tenor saxophone provides support and harmony for the alto saxophone. Its deeper, rounder sound adds a warm and resonant foundation to the duet. The tenor saxophone player's ability to maintain a steady rhythm and provide a solid harmonic base is essential for the success of the performance.
The Duet's Dynamics
The arrangement for alto and tenor saxophone explores a wide range of dynamics, from soft and introspective to soaring and triumphant. The players must work together to create a balanced and cohesive sound, ensuring that each instrument's voice is heard while maintaining the overall flow and momentum of the piece.
Performance Tips
- Listen to each other. Communication between the alto and tenor saxophone players is crucial for achieving a unified sound and cohesive interpretation.
- Practice together. Regular rehearsals are essential for building familiarity with the arrangement and developing a rapport between the players.
- Use a metronome. Maintaining a steady tempo is important for keeping the piece grounded and providing a solid foundation for improvisation.
- Experiment with articulation. Varying the way notes are attacked and released can add character and depth to the performance.
- Be expressive. "Amazing Grace" is a deeply emotional hymn. Allow your emotions to guide your interpretation, creating a performance that resonates with the audience.
